In this project, we aimed to build an ML model to predict the price to hire a venue space in London (e.g. for work drinks or family event etc.) based on the characteristics of the space (location, capacity etc.). Venues could use this model to optimise their pricing and maximise their revenues, ensuring they are not under or over priced.
The model was trained on data that we scraped from the Tagvenue website. Tagvenue provides a service similar to AirBnB but for finding and booking venues for an event. The website hosts thousands of venues in the UK that can be booked for events.

- Our best model was a Gradient Boosted Tree Reggressor with a test error of £977 (for a median price of £1000)
- The model we created was not accurate enough to be useful and so unfortunately we did not succeed in creating a useful venue hire pricing model.
- We think the poor performance of the model is mainly due to the poor quality of the Tagvenue data we collected. During exploration, we only found a single highly correlated variable ('max_seated_or_standing'). Neither the engineering of geographical based pricing features nor the use of different models ever dramatically improved the performance.
- Either the pricing data was unreliable (perhaps because venues rarely update the prices or provided misleading or inaccurate pricing) or the key variables that set venue space pricing are absent from the Tagvenue website.
- A key takewaway is summed up in the phrase 'bad data in, bad data out' - In future, we would perform basic correlation / exploration checks on data as soon as possible (i.e. before a thorough cleaning or in depth exploration). You are probably better off spending the time finding new, better data if the critical correlations / associations with the target variable are missing.
